B.C. Transit disclosed 909 employees in the BC Public Sector Compensation Disclosure for 2023-2024. Average disclosed compensation is $102,691, and the highest single disclosed figure is $354,643. This is public-sector compensation disclosure (remuneration and expenses) as published by covered organizations. It is not a general wage survey.

Methodology and limits

British Columbia public-sector compensation records include remuneration and expenses disclosed by provincial bodies, health authorities, school districts, Crown corporations, universities, colleges, municipalities, and regional districts.

Fields indexed: name, job title, employer, year, remuneration, expenses

Reporting periods may be fiscal-year based rather than calendar-year based. Expense fields are not equivalent to salary.
